Abstract

Ontology has recently received considerable attention in the knowledge management community. This article discusses the needs of ontology development for data mining. Based on a domain analysis of knowledge representations in data mining, it proposes a generic structure of ontologies for data mining. Furthermore, this article specifies the unique ontology resources of the subdomain of innovative data mining with incomplete data. A project on an ontology-based data mining system for discovering knowledge from incomplete data demonstrates the effectiveness of ontology in knowledge management.
